x.getNanos(), zoneOffset / 1000);
break;
case Types.SQL_TIME :
millis = HsqlDateTime.getNormalisedTime(millis);
parameterValues[i] = new TimeData((int) (millis / 1000),
x.getNanos(), 0);
break;
case Types.SQL_TIME_WITH_TIME_ZONE :
zoneOffset = HsqlDateTime.getZoneMillis(calendar, millis);
parameterValues[i] = new TimeData((int) (millis / 1000),
x.getNanos(), zoneOffset / 1000);
break;
case Types.SQL_DATE :
millis = HsqlDateTime.getNormalisedDate(millis);